Bulk Editing of Critical Depreciation Fields

Important Information

  • Bulk Edit can only change Depreciation Method and Estimated life. For other fields, see How to change critical depreciation fields.
  • You only have Bulk Edit available in Sage Fixed Assets Depreciation, Depreciation Network and Premier Depreciation products. It’s only for U.S. Companies.
  • If you see Bulk Edit grayed out, it's disabled in password security. See How to set up Password Security.
  • To limit assets impacted by Bulk Edit, you can create a group. See How to create a group.

Bulk Editing

  1. Perform a back up before proceeding with the next step. The only way to undo bulk edit is to restore your backup.
  2. Open your company and go to Depreciation, Bulk Edit.
  3. Welcome: If you have a current backup of your data, check I have a current backup and click next.
  4. Groups and Books: Select the desired Group and Books and click Next.
  5. Fields to Edit: Check the fields you want to change. Make the desired value selections in the From and To dropdowns. Click Next.
  6. Effective Date: Select when you want the change to take effect. Ensure you know and understand the effects of your selection.
    • Placed-in-Service Date: Clears all depreciation and beginning information from the asset. Recalculate assets from their Placed-in-Service Date.
    • Retain Begin Info: This checkbox clears all current depreciation information except for existing Beginning information on assets
    • Current Thru Date: All current depreciation information will move into the beginning fields.
    • Only change assets with a Current Thru Date of: Limits changes to only assets with the selected date type.
  7. Validation:
    1. Click Validate to pull the validation report.
      • Valid: The asset will change.
      • Warning: The asset will change, but you can see other effects or issues later. For example, removal of 168 Allowance amounts.
      • Error: The asset can’t change to the selected values.
    2. Review the report and click Execute. The program will create a report showing changes made.
      Note: Re-run Depreciation before seeing changes on reports.
